Monarch calls for inter-ethnic peace building committee in Taraba

From Godwin Agia, Jalingo
The Ter Tiv Zamfara, leader of the Tiv ethnic group in Zamfara State, His highness, Zaki Dr. Abaver Joel Terkuram has called for the establishment of inter-ethnic peace building committee in Taraba State to help tame the incessant crisis between the various ethnic groups in the State.
The monarch made this call while presenting a paper titled; Principles of Effective Leadership Among Tiv Traditional Leadership in the Maintenance of Peace, Unity and Progress in a Divided and Multi-lingual Society at the occasion of the celebration of Silver Jubilee of Tiv Traditional leadership in Bali.
The monarch cum university don, pointed out that establishing a committee of that kind would go along way to resolve skirmishes at their early stage and set the entire state on the fast lane of development and prosperity.
He encouraged inter-ethnic dialogues and visitations, development of joint economic empowerment initiatives and development projects as well as provision of modern mediation techniques, saying they would serve in no small measure in resolving inter-ethnic conflicts between waring parties in any part of the state.
While charging leaders to always show the way and guide their people towards attaining peaceful and sustainable development, the monarch noted that “leaders are everywhere but there is scarcity of quality leadership of building people in our time”.
Citing Biblical injunctions to buttress his position, Dr Terkuram, urged leaders to emulate the leadership style of Joseph, Moses, Joshua, David and Apostle Paul, stating that the effective roles they played in their leadership positions relieved their subjects from dreaded jaws of frustration.
He lamented that instead of having transformational leaders, our societies were pathetically and ironically, engulfed with transactional leaders, hence development is retarded in most of our communities.
“A transformational leader is that who inspires and empowers his followers to achieved a shared vision, fostering innovations and positive changes within an environment or community”. He explained.
Dr Terkuram lauded the leadership of Tiv ethnic group of Bali LGA for transforming their stoolship to an enviable position through an effective traditional and socio cultural leadership that has remained robust, resolute, resilience and has much more been preserves over the decades and urged others to emulate them.
Meanwhile, the Jubilee celebration which commenced on Thursday, is expected to climaxed with presentation of awards, book launch, crowning of Face of Tiv known as “Kumashe U Tiv” and conferment of traditional titles on distinguished personalities among other things on Saturday, 30th November, 2024.
